Faith is an Act and Overcoming Spiritual Opposition

The Truth

There is a profound reason it is called an act of faith. Faith is never meant to be passive belief alone, because faith without works is dead, just as works without faith are entirely empty. Once God speaks a clear word into your life, our mandate is absolute: we must completely yield to His commands and execute them without questioning or second-guessing.

1. The Screaming Voices of Opposition

When we get caught up in endless questioning, what we are actually experiencing is the enemy screaming at us. This opposition frequently manifests as an uncomfortable, unexplainable physical sensation — tightness in the chest, anxiety, or sudden dread — that tries to paralyze us and prevent us from moving forward.

Think of the sheer volume of the spiritual battlefield: a thousand voices whispering in your ear at once. "Don't do it, it's too scary." "You'll never get that job anyway." "Don't call them, you're way too overqualified (or underqualified)." "You won't like the culture there."

The enemy throws every doubt at you, even when you have received undeniable, unmistakable instruction straight from God.

2. Upending Fear Through the Holy Spirit

You do not have to fight this physical manifestation of fear in your own strength. When those sensations of hesitation hit you, turn inward to prayer.

Specifically tell the Holy Spirit in your thoughts where that fear is physically manifesting in your body. Name the tension, bring it into the light, and ask Him to remove it. As you surrender that physical resistance to Him, He will faithfully replace it with His unshakeable peace.

Over time, as you make this a daily discipline, the stronghold of fear and hesitation will lose its grip and leave you permanently.
